The median home value in Knifley, KY is $185,000.
This is
higher than
the county median home value of $138,000.
The national median home value is $308,980.
The average price of homes sold in Knifley, KY is $185,000.
Approximately 68% of Knifley homes are owned,
compared to 14% rented, while
17% are vacant.

This 20.5-acre tract is located on Atilla Road near Campbellsville, Kentucky, within Larue County, and directly along the Taylor County line. The property consists of predominantly wooded acreage with rolling terrain and established access, offering flexibility for residential development, recreational use, or long-term land investment. Its location provides a rural setting while remaining within reasonable driving distance of nearby towns and services. The land is primarily timbered and includes a mix of hardwood species, with several white oak trees present that may hold future timber value depending on management goals and market conditions. The wooded layout provides natural screening and privacy from surrounding properties while maintaining usable interior space. The terrain across the tract is gently rolling, which supports multiple potential building locations, subject to buyer verification of zoning, septic suitability, and local requirements. An existing road runs through the property as part of an easement providing access to neighboring land beyond this tract. According to the seller, this easement is infrequently used. The road also serves as an interior access route, allowing convenient movement across the property for foot traffic, equipment access, or land management activities. Buyers should review easement documentation as part of their due diligence. Utilities are available at the road frontage, including electric service, reducing the need for extended infrastructure installation if a buyer chooses to pursue residential construction. This accessibility supports a range of potential uses, including a primary residence, weekend retreat, or future improvements. Buyers are encouraged to confirm utility availability and connection requirements with local providers. From a recreational standpoint, the wooded acreage provides cover and habitat commonly associated with deer and other wildlife found in this region. Wildlife presence varies naturally by season and surrounding land use, but the property's timber cover and limited disturbance may support recreational hunting opportunities or wildlife observation. The size and layout also make the tract suitable for general outdoor recreation or a private wooded retreat. The property's location offers access to nearby communities and amenities. Campbellsville is approximately 12 miles east and offers grocery stores, dining, healthcare, schools, and retail services. Hodgenville is roughly 18 miles to the north, offering additional local amenities and services. Greensburg is approximately 20 miles to the west, providing further shopping and dining options. Elizabethtown is about 35 miles northeast, offering expanded commercial services and access to major highways. This 20.5-acre tract offers wooded land, marketable timber potential, interior access, and utilities at the road.
